发布时间:2023-04-20 20:22:51
全微程序设计团队是一家专注于JAVA/PYTHON/PHP/ASP/安卓/小程序开发的软件开发团队,十年开发经验让我身经百战,若您有需求而我们恰好专业。
同时,我们也有文稿文档代写服务,文档降重润文服务,好评如潮,期待您的光临哦。
今天将为大家分析一个基于微信小程序的美容店管理系统,基于微信小程序的美容店管理系统项目使用框架为PHP,选用开发工具为phpstorm。
系统具备添加管理员模块,在添加管理员中通过获取管理员的详细信息,可以将页面中管理员信息提交到数据库中,输入管理员的详细信息,包括管理员id、账号、管理员、,输入完成后,点击添加按钮。在addadmin页面输入管理员详细信息,将提交到admin类的addadminact方法中,通过id、username、admin、字段进行接收,执行调用adminmapper中的insert方法执行insert sql语句将Admin对象提交到t_admin表中,完成添加Admin操作。
该部分的核心代码如下:
// 输出当前方法日志,表示正在执行AdminService.addAdminact方法
logger.debug("AdminService.addAdminact ......");
// 使用Admindao的insert方法将Admin添加到数据库中
Admindao.insert(Admin);
// 将添加Admin信息添加到request中用message参数进行保存
request.setAttribute("message", "添加管理员成功");
执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。
添加管理员页面如下所示。
图添加管理员界面
系统中具有管理员模块,该模块参与者为用户,具体的实现功能包括用户对管理员进行添加、修改、删除、查询。
实现功能需具备的类及接口
| 类(接口)名称 | 位置 | 说明 |
|---|---|---|
| AdminController.java | org.mypro.front包 | 管理员控制层,用于接受请求 |
| AdminServiceImp.java | org.mypro.service包 | 管理员服务层接口,管理员控制层调用接口完成管理员相关数据处理 |
| AdminService.java | org.mypro.service包 | AdminServiceImp接口的实现类,用于具体的管理员逻辑处理 |
| AdminMapper.java | org.mypro.dao包 | 管理员Dao层接口,用于处理管理员的数据与MySQL同步 |
| AdminMapper.xml | org.mypro.dao包 | AdminMapper的实现,用于mybatis的sql语句编写,具体的管理员数据处理实现 |
| Admin.java | org.mypro.entity包 | 管理员的实体类,用于记录管理员的所有属性 |
| AdminExample.java | org.mypro.entity包 | 管理员mybatis逆向工程动态sql拼接条件类 |
系统具备添加美容产品模块,在添加美容产品中通过获取美容产品的详细信息,可以将页面中美容产品信息提交到数据库中,输入美容产品的详细信息,包括美容产品、种类、作用、类型、价格、名称、,输入完成后,点击添加按钮。在addmeirongchanpin页面输入美容产品详细信息,将提交到meirongchanpin类的addmeirongchanpinact方法中,通过meirongchanpin、zhonglei、zuoyong、leixing、jiage、mingcheng、字段进行接收,执行调用meirongchanpinmapper中的insert方法执行insert sql语句将Meirongchanpin对象提交到t_meirongchanpin表中,完成添加Meirongchanpin操作。
该部分的核心代码如下:
// 输出当前方法日志,表示正在执行MeirongchanpinService.addMeirongchanpinact方法
logger.debug("MeirongchanpinService.addMeirongchanpinact ......");
// 使用Meirongchanpindao的insert方法将Meirongchanpin添加到数据库中
Meirongchanpindao.insert(Meirongchanpin);
// 将添加Meirongchanpin信息添加到request中用message参数进行保存
request.setAttribute("message", "添加美容产品成功");
执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。
添加美容产品页面如下所示。
图添加美容产品界面
系统中具有美容产品模块,该模块参与者为用户,具体的实现功能包括用户对美容产品进行添加、修改、删除、查询。
实现功能需具备的类及接口
| 类(接口)名称 | 位置 | 说明 |
|---|---|---|
| MeirongchanpinController.java | org.mypro.front包 | 美容产品控制层,用于接受请求 |
| MeirongchanpinServiceImp.java | org.mypro.service包 | 美容产品服务层接口,美容产品控制层调用接口完成美容产品相关数据处理 |
| MeirongchanpinService.java | org.mypro.service包 | MeirongchanpinServiceImp接口的实现类,用于具体的美容产品逻辑处理 |
| MeirongchanpinMapper.java | org.mypro.dao包 | 美容产品Dao层接口,用于处理美容产品的数据与MySQL同步 |
| MeirongchanpinMapper.xml | org.mypro.dao包 | MeirongchanpinMapper的实现,用于mybatis的sql语句编写,具体的美容产品数据处理实现 |
| Meirongchanpin.java | org.mypro.entity包 | 美容产品的实体类,用于记录美容产品的所有属性 |
| MeirongchanpinExample.java | org.mypro.entity包 | 美容产品mybatis逆向工程动态sql拼接条件类 |
系统具备添加美容咨询模块,在添加美容咨询中通过获取美容咨询的详细信息,可以将页面中美容咨询信息提交到数据库中,输入美容咨询的详细信息,包括美容咨询id、咨询时间、咨询人、咨询结果、美容咨询、,输入完成后,点击添加按钮。在addmeirongzixun页面输入美容咨询详细信息,将提交到meirongzixun类的addmeirongzixunact方法中,通过id、zixunshijian、zixunren、zixunjieguo、meirongzixun、字段进行接收,执行调用meirongzixunmapper中的insert方法执行insert sql语句将Meirongzixun对象提交到t_meirongzixun表中,完成添加Meirongzixun操作。
该部分的核心代码如下:
// 输出当前方法日志,表示正在执行MeirongzixunService.addMeirongzixunact方法
logger.debug("MeirongzixunService.addMeirongzixunact ......");
// 使用Meirongzixundao的insert方法将Meirongzixun添加到数据库中
Meirongzixundao.insert(Meirongzixun);
// 将添加Meirongzixun信息添加到request中用message参数进行保存
request.setAttribute("message", "添加美容咨询成功");
执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。
添加美容咨询页面如下所示。
图添加美容咨询界面
系统中具有美容咨询模块,该模块参与者为用户,具体的实现功能包括用户对美容咨询进行添加、修改、删除、查询。
实现功能需具备的类及接口
| 类(接口)名称 | 位置 | 说明 |
|---|---|---|
| MeirongzixunController.java | org.mypro.front包 | 美容咨询控制层,用于接受请求 |
| MeirongzixunServiceImp.java | org.mypro.service包 | 美容咨询服务层接口,美容咨询控制层调用接口完成美容咨询相关数据处理 |
| MeirongzixunService.java | org.mypro.service包 | MeirongzixunServiceImp接口的实现类,用于具体的美容咨询逻辑处理 |
| MeirongzixunMapper.java | org.mypro.dao包 | 美容咨询Dao层接口,用于处理美容咨询的数据与MySQL同步 |
| MeirongzixunMapper.xml | org.mypro.dao包 | MeirongzixunMapper的实现,用于mybatis的sql语句编写,具体的美容咨询数据处理实现 |
| Meirongzixun.java | org.mypro.entity包 | 美容咨询的实体类,用于记录美容咨询的所有属性 |
| MeirongzixunExample.java | org.mypro.entity包 | 美容咨询mybatis逆向工程动态sql拼接条件类 |
系统具备添加用户模块,在添加用户中通过获取用户的详细信息,可以将页面中用户信息提交到数据库中,输入用户的详细信息,包括用户、账号、用户id、姓名、密码、性别、,输入完成后,点击添加按钮。在addyonghu页面输入用户详细信息,将提交到yonghu类的addyonghuact方法中,通过yonghu、username、id、xingming、password、xingbie、字段进行接收,执行调用yonghumapper中的insert方法执行insert sql语句将Yonghu对象提交到t_yonghu表中,完成添加Yonghu操作。
该部分的核心代码如下:
// 输出当前方法日志,表示正在执行YonghuService.addYonghuact方法
logger.debug("YonghuService.addYonghuact ......");
// 使用Yonghudao的insert方法将Yonghu添加到数据库中
Yonghudao.insert(Yonghu);
// 将添加Yonghu信息添加到request中用message参数进行保存
request.setAttribute("message", "添加用户成功");
执行insert sql语句完成后,将使用request的setAttribute保存处理完成信息,并给出页面提示信息。
添加用户页面如下所示。
图添加用户界面
系统中具有用户模块,该模块参与者为用户,具体的实现功能包括用户对用户进行添加、修改、删除、查询。
实现功能需具备的类及接口
| 类(接口)名称 | 位置 | 说明 |
|---|---|---|
| YonghuController.java | org.mypro.front包 | 用户控制层,用于接受请求 |
| YonghuServiceImp.java | org.mypro.service包 | 用户服务层接口,用户控制层调用接口完成用户相关数据处理 |
| YonghuService.java | org.mypro.service包 | YonghuServiceImp接口的实现类,用于具体的用户逻辑处理 |
| YonghuMapper.java | org.mypro.dao包 | 用户Dao层接口,用于处理用户的数据与MySQL同步 |
| YonghuMapper.xml | org.mypro.dao包 | YonghuMapper的实现,用于mybatis的sql语句编写,具体的用户数据处理实现 |
| Yonghu.java | org.mypro.entity包 | 用户的实体类,用于记录用户的所有属性 |
| YonghuExample.java | org.mypro.entity包 | 用户mybatis逆向工程动态sql拼接条件类 |
专业程序代做
为你量身定制的程序设计
诚信经营,我们将尽心尽力为你完成指定功能
十年程序经验,尽在全微程序设计